Webbington remains a quiet enclave where the limestone ribs of the Mendip Hills meet the expansive, fertile levels of Somerset. It lies 3.1 miles west of Axbridge (from Axbridge: bearing 281°T, OS grid ST 381 555), and is situated east-south-east of Loxton village. The morning light often catches the high, pale slopes of Crook Peak, casting long shadows that stretch toward the low-lying fields. Here, the Old Lox Yeo winds its way through the verdant floor, a slender ribbon of water that has mirrored the shifting seasons for centuries. Webbington retains a singular, enduring composure, defined by the ancient stone of the Churchyard Cross in St Andrew's Churchyard which stands as a silent witness to the passage of time. The air here holds the scent of damp earth and the sharp, clean clarity of the hills, far removed from the clamour of busier roads. Farmsteads and heritage sites mark the landscape, preserving a character that values the slow turning of the year above the frantic pace of modernity.
